Source Setup file Frequency sets Observing hours (duplicates not shown) Scan Baseline RSOPH sess221.C2048e 1 2 3 4 5 6 7 8 9 10 14 15 4.847 626.609 VLASS1 sess221.C2048e 1 2 3 4 5 6 7 8 9 10 14 15 0.681 87.276 J1310+3220 sess221.C2048e 1 2 3 4 5 6 7 8 9 10 14 15 1.717 293.550 J1608+1029 sess221.C2048e 1 2 3 4 5 6 7 8 9 10 14 15 1.717 293.550 J1745-0753 sess221.C2048e 1 2 3 4 5 6 7 8 9 10 14 15 1.069 133.064 1749+096 sess221.C2048e 1 2 3 4 5 6 7 8 9 10 14 15 0.067 11.400 3C454.3 sess221.C2048e 1 2 3 4 5 6 8 9 10 14 15 0.075 11.348 EFFECT OF SOLAR CORONA The solar corona can cause unstable phases for sources too close to the Sun. SCHED provides warnings at individual scans for distances less than 10 degrees. The distance from the Sun to each source in this schedule is: Source Sun distance (deg) RSOPH 70.2 VLASS1 70.2 J1310+3220 39.5 J1608+1029 48.5 J1745-0753 68.9 1749+096 72.8 3C454.3 146.2 Barry Clark estimates from predictions by Ketan Desai of IPM scattering sizes that the Sun will cause amplitude reductions on the longest VLBA baselines at a solar distance of 60deg F^(-0.6) where F is in GHz. For common VLBI bands, this is: 327 MHz 117. deg 610 MHz 81. deg 1.6 GHz 45. deg 2.3 GHz 36. deg 5.0 GHz 23. deg 8.4 GHz 17. deg 15.0 GHz 12. deg 22.0 GHz 9. deg 43.0 GHz 6. deg
